Electrical shock is one of the most frequent workplace injuries caused by power tools. Electrical shock can occur when a person comes into contact with a component or wire that is powered up or when an operator is able to walk across a live cable. The shock that occurs could be severe, or even fatal. A good rule to remember is that if you feel electricity rushing through your body, immediately unplug and turn off the device.
The inability to ground electric extension cords and tools is a different risk. According to the CPWR, these types of problems are among the most frequent OSHA citations for workplace accidents. Workers should make sure that all electrical tools have three-prong grounded plugs or are double-insulated and listed by Underwriters' Laboratories. Workers should also never place an extension cable in a damp or wet place or near a heating source or oil.
Workers who use power tools must wear the appropriate personal protection equipment. This includes a dust mask, hearing protection and other items depending on the job. They should also adhere to safe work practices, such as wearing loose clothing that doesn't catch on moving parts while keeping their feet and Power Tools Store hands away from sharp edges, and maintaining a firm grasp on the tool so that they don't drop it and injure themselves. In addition, workers must be trained in lockout/tagout procedures to avoid accidental start-up of machinery during maintenance or repairs.
